Black Friday death at a Wal-Mart


By Yael T. Abouhalkah, Kansas City Star Editorial Page columnist

A crowd of shoppers trampled a store worker to death while rushing toward Black Friday specials at a Long Island Wal-Mart.

It's an appalling event, made even more newsworthy by the fact that American shoppers have been encouraged in recent days to make sure they get out and spend money to boost the economy.

Obviously, no one wanted anything like this event to occur.

Witnesses said a worker at a Wal-Mart in Long Island died after he tried to hold shoppers back before the scheduled 5 a.m. opening of the store.

But the stock clerk was run over by "unruly crowds," according to a report in the New York Daily News.

"As he gasped for air, shoppers ran over and around him," the paper reported.

Police closed the store during the investigation of the death.

That decision probably angered a lot of shoppers but it was the proper thing to do.

Minister told of loyalist threat 

Conor Murphy said police told him of the threat
Regional Development Minister Conor Murphy has said he has been told of an attempt to murder him at the weekend.

The Newry and Armagh Sinn Féin MP said police told him loyalist paramilitaries calling themselves the Orange Volunteers were behind the attempt.

He said he was told the group claimed to have carried out the murder bid "over the weekend in the Newry area".

The police said they "do not comment on the personal security arrangements of individuals".

"Where we become aware that someone needs to review their security we take steps to inform them immediately. We never ignore anything that would put anyone at risk," a spokesman said.

Mr Murphy said that as a "long-time" member of Sinn Féin he was used to such threats, but added that it was an issue of concern for his family.

"This is part and parcel of being involved with Sinn Féin," he said.

"Unfortunately for too many of our members it has cost them their lives and I think we are always conscious of that."
